diff --git a/llvm/projects/hpvm-tensor-rt/code_autogenerators/source_code_autogenerator.py b/llvm/projects/hpvm-tensor-rt/code_autogenerators/source_code_autogenerator.py
index 5c7ffc097fd12b2670b5f63177b9e45af40ee42a..fee5da4169c10065cb2a6ca84747fd6954ae54f9 100644
--- a/llvm/projects/hpvm-tensor-rt/code_autogenerators/source_code_autogenerator.py
+++ b/llvm/projects/hpvm-tensor-rt/code_autogenerators/source_code_autogenerator.py
@@ -84,7 +84,8 @@ def generate_source_code(table, dir_name, filename, source_name):
         new_file = open(new_filename, "w")
         new_file.write(''.join(new_file_contents))
         new_file.close()
-
+        print("Generated source code for configuration %s as %s" \
+                        % (knob_config.new_func_call, new_filename))
     source_file.close()
 
 
@@ -107,21 +108,22 @@ def generate_all_sources(table, orig_files_filename):
             source_name = orig_filename[ : file_ext_ind]
         else:
             source_name = orig_filename[last_slash_ind + 1 : file_ext_ind]
-        print("SOURCE NAME: %s" % source_name)
+        print("Source name: %s" % source_name)
        
         # Start with a clean directory
         dir_name = "%s_autogenerated_knobs" % source_name
+        print("Setting up directory: %s" % dir_name)
         if os.path.isdir(dir_name):
-            print("DIRECTORY %s EXISTS: CLEARING EVERYTHING" % dir_name)
+            print("Directory exists: clearing everything")
             for old_file in glob.glob(os.path.join(dir_name, "*")):
                 os.remove(old_file)
 
         else:
-            dir_name = "%s_autogenerated_knobs" % source_name
-            print("GENERATING DIRECTORY: %s" % dir_name)
+            print("Generating directory: %s" % dir_name)
             os.makedirs(dir_name)
             
         generate_source_code(table, dir_name, orig_filename, source_name)
+        print("\n")
     orig_files.close()